Huddersfield Giants man makes surprise positional switch as Wigan Warriors flyer set for World Cup clash

The team news is in for Lebanon vs Jamaica.

It’s a must win game for Lebanon who want to confirm their place in the last eight with a win.

A victory would indeed see them meet World Cup holders Australia in next week’s quarter-finals and Wigan Warriors flyer Abbas Miski is set to feature in the game with the chance of coming up against some of the world’s best on the cards with a win.

On the other wing, Josh Mansour, who is looking for a club and could join Super League, features.

Adam Doueihi returns from his ban for “foul and abusive language” towards a match official to fill the void left at fullback for Lebanon.

As for Jamaica skipper Ash Golding starts at loose-forward which is a role he has never played in Super League before.

A fullback by trade, he has played on the wing for Huddersfield Giants in 2022 as well as at nine which is a role he played for Leeds Rhinos in 2018.

He was given the number 13 shirt but started at nine against Ireland as he did against New Zealand but plays his first ever game in the role.

His Huddersfield Giants teammate Michael Lawrence starts at prop whilst the scorer of Jamaica’s first World Cup try ex-Leeds Rhinos star Ben Jones-Bishop is at fullback.
